Sappi North America<\/strong><strong><\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Headquarters: <\/strong>Boston, Massachusetts (corporate office in Portland, Maine)<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Established: <\/strong>1854 (Westbrook Mill heritage); Sappi acquired 1994<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Sappi North America is one of the largest coated paper producers in the United States. Their flagship Somerset Mill in central Maine \u2014 set on 2,500 acres \u2014 is an integrated pulping and papermaking operation producing graphic papers, packaging and label papers, and bleached chemical pulp. Their Westbrook Mill in Maine traces its heritage to 1854 as the manufacturing hub of the S.D. Warren Company, an early pioneer in coated printing papers. Sappi&#8217;s Cloquet Mill in Minnesota produces premium graphic papers including McCoy, Opus, and Flo, plus the LusterCote label paper. Sappi is widely recognized as the leading premium coated paper brand in North America.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Key products: <\/strong>McCoy, Opus, Flo, LusterCote, premium coated freesheet, coated label paper, packaging papers<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Industries served: <\/strong>Magazine and catalog publishing, premium printing, point-of-purchase displays, label converting<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>2. Match the supplier to the grade you need, not the brand: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>Premium magazine and catalog: Sappi (Somerset, Cloquet) leads on premium coated freesheet<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Lightweight coated for catalogs: Twin Rivers, Resolute, and Evergreen are relevant<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Coated paperboard for packaging: WestRock, Clearwater, International Paper dominate<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Sustainable \/ recycled coated: American Eagle for high recycled content<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Specialty engineered coated: Glatfelter, Twin Rivers<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Specifications to Demand<\/strong><strong><\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>Basis weight (gsm) with stated tolerance<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Coat weight per side<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Brightness (ISO\/TAPPI)<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Gloss level (75\u00b0 gloss reading)<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Smoothness (Bekk, Parker Print-Surf, or Sheffield)<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Opacity for double-sided printing<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>FSC, SFI, or PEFC chain-of-custody<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Recycled content percentage if relevant<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>US Coated Paper Industry Context<\/strong><strong><\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>The US coated <a href=\"https:\/\/kangchuangpapers.com\/zh\/industry-insights-for-roll-newsprint-kangchuang-paper-industry-co-ltd\/\">paper industry<\/a> has gone through major capacity changes since 2018. Verso Corporation (a major US coated paper producer) was acquired and integrated into Billerud Americas in 2022 \u2014 Verso&#8217;s Duluth and Wisconsin Rapids mills had produced 810,000 tons of coated and supercalendered paper annually. Sappi&#8217;s Stockstadt and Westbrook mill operations have been adjusted. Several mills have converted from coated paper to packaging grades or shut down. Buyers should verify current production capability with any supplier before locking in long-term volume.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Frequently Asked Questions<\/strong><strong><\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Why has US coated paper capacity declined?<\/strong><strong><\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Demand for coated freesheet and coated groundwood has fallen as magazine and catalog volumes have shifted to digital. Many traditional coated paper mills have converted to coated paperboard for packaging (where demand has grown), shifted to specialty grades, or closed entirely. The remaining producers tend to be either large diversified groups or focused specialty mills.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Is most US coated paper imported?<\/strong><strong><\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>A meaningful portion is, particularly lightweight coated grades and specialty premium coated paper from European and Asian producers. However, US-based production through Sappi, Twin Rivers, and others remains significant. For buyers with US-content requirements, several domestic options remain available.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Can I get FSC-certified coated paper from US mills?<\/strong><strong><\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Yes. Sappi, Domtar, Clearwater, American Eagle, and most major US producers offer FSC-certified coated grades. The certification adds modest cost but is standard for many corporate procurement programs.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>What is the lead time on US coated paper orders?<\/strong><strong><\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Standard grades from large producers typically ship within 2\u20134 weeks. Specialty conversions, custom basis weights, or non-standard finishes can run 6\u201312 weeks.
